Christian Eriksen, the Manchester United midfielder, suffered an injury on Saturday, and the club may attempt to make a late transfer window move.

Following Christian Eriksen’s injury, Erik ten Hag is said to be considering a deal for Leicester City’s Youri Tielemans.

The Belgium international’s contract with Leicester expires this summer, and Football365 reports that Manchester United is interested in signing him.

Brendan Rodgers has done all possible to keep the former Anderlecht man, but United may now be the favorites to sign him if their injury woes increase in the coming weeks.

In other news, United are thought to be facing a £120 million cost if they want to sign Harry Kane this summer.

Ten Hag just signed Burnley striker Wout Weghorst on loan until the end of the 2022/23 season, with Kane and Napoli star Victor Osimhen both on their radar heading into the summer.

According to the Daily Star, Kane would cost the club around £120 million, with extras and bonuses bringing the total to a whopping £300 million.

Qualifying for the Champions League might be crucial in United’s pursuit of the Three Lions captain, with Antonio Conte’s side presently three points behind United in the table despite having played one more game.
